ANDERSON ~ Theodore Anthony Anderson was born to Belinda Ferguson and the late Charles Doles, Sr. November 7, 1972. He attended Hilliard High School and enjoyed playing football and basketball.
Theodore was a friendly, kind person who helped everyone he could. He was a “tear up mechanic” – he enjoyed taking things apart but could not put them back together.
